George L Wise, 95, of Wooster, passed away peacefully February 5, 2025 at his home surrounded by his family.
George was born July 14, 1929 in New Philadelphia to Luther and Maggie {Kurth} Wise.
He married Shirley Zellner on September 25, 1954 in Willard. She survives.
George was a lifelong dairy farmer and retired from Okey’s Alignment after many years of service. He was a member of Salem Lutheran Church as well as West Salem Lodge # 398 F&AM. George was also a member of the American Jersey Cattle Association. He enjoyed coon and mushroom hunting, pitching horseshoes, reading, and playing softball. George loved spending time with his family especially his children and grandchildren.
George will be deeply missed by his wife; children Dennis (Susan) Wise, Garald Wise, Beth Ann (Tim) Zimmerman and Sherrill Wise; 10 grandchildren; 14 (and 1 on way) great-grandchildren; a brother Kenny (Nancy) Wise and sister Hazel Willett.
He was preceded in death by his parents, daughter-in-law Wendy Johnson Wise, and siblings Jim, Charles, Ross, Roy, Fred, Frank, John, Gertrude, and Elsie.
Graveside services will be Monday at 1 p.m at the Salem Cemetery, 5167 Canaan Center Rd, Wooster with Tim Barrage officiating.
